A Tiny Free Little Art Gallery, Minneapolis, MN


A Tiny Free Little Art Gallery, Minneapolis, MN

Find this one at 4521 45th Ave. S., Minneapolis, MN 55406 (inside the Little Free Library).

Art is accepted by mail! Send to:
Sharon Parker, 4521 45th Ave. S., Minneapolis, MN 55406

She writes, “It’s a box inside of my Little Free Library, which I designed to fit among the books, so art is limited to 3×5 inches or smaller. ATCs especially welcome. Very short poems and stories also welcome, as long as they fit on a 3×5 card (or equivalent). Zines too! I will mail tiny art back to people who send me art for the FLAG.”

No Instagram or online presence for this one, so enjoy it in person and by mail!
